The Winchester Model 1895 in 30-40 Krag is a centerfire lever-action rifle built on one of America's most storied designs. Originally chambered for the 30-40 Krag cartridge—a round that saw service with the U.S. military—this rifle carries the DNA of the original 1895, the same action that earned the respect of hunters and soldiers worldwide. With its straight-grip Grade III/IV walnut stock, button-rifled barrel, and traditional cut checkering, this is a rifle that appeals to hunters and collectors who value classic American craftsmanship and reliable lever-action performance in a heritage package.
The receiver and barrel wear a gloss blued finish that gives the rifle its timeless appearance. You'll find a top tang safety, Marble Arms gold bead front sight, and buckhorn rear sight ready to go out of the box. The receiver is drilled and tapped for side mount optics, so you can modernize the sight picture if your hunting demands it while keeping the classic lines intact. The non-detachable box magazine—innovative for its time—keeps things simple and reliable, exactly as Winchester intended.
This is a rifle for those who respect what came before: hunters working open country or timber, shooters who prefer the tactile engagement of a lever action, and collectors who understand that some designs simply don't need reinvention. The 30-40 Krag delivers adequate power for deer and similar game at reasonable distances, and the Model 1895 platform is proven across more than a century of use. | Brand | Winchester |
| Model | 1895 |
| Chambering | 30-40 Krag |
| Barrel Length | 24 inches |
| Action Type | Lever-action |
| Safety | Top tang |
| Receiver | Steel, gloss blued finish |
| Barrel | Button rifled, gloss blued finish |
| Stock | Grade III/IV walnut, straight grip, traditional cut checkering |
| Magazine Type | Non-detachable box magazine |
| Front Sight | Marble Arms gold bead |
| Rear Sight | Buckhorn |
| Mounting | Drilled and tapped for side-mount optics |
